Understanding Zipper Sizes
Fortunately, many zipper manufacturers have made it very easy to identify a zipper size by simply stamping a number on the back of the slider. This number will tell you the width of the zipper teeth when the zipper is closed as measured in millimetres and is often written out as #3, #5, #8 or so on.
Generally speaking, lightweight garments will use a thinner zipper (indicated with a smaller number) while heavy-duty items such as tents and luggage will have wider zippers (indicated with a larger number).
What happens if there isn’t a number on my zipper?
What happens if you simply can’t find a number? Well, don’t panic — just reach for your tape measure and measure the width of the zipper teeth in millimetres. Again, you can already have a hint about the size of the zipper based on the type of product and its use.
What type of zipper should I get?
After you’ve got the size of the zipper figured out, you’ll also need to make sure that you’re matching the right material. This can range from nylon zippers, which are typically used for more flexible and lightweight purposes, to metal zippers, which will be used when durability is needed.
